Damages recovered for injuries arising as a result of a negligent prescription of incorrect medication
Our client received Enalapril medication 10mg to assist in reducing his blood pressure.
Our client attended the Lloyds pharmacy, 30 Church Road, Garston, L19 2LW, for his prescription of Enalapril 10mg. Our client was negligently prescribed Escitalopram 10mg tablets, rather than his usual prescription of Enalapril 10mg tablets. Our client took the medication home and began taking the same.

Damages recovered for client on behalf of the Estate of her deceased husband v Liverpool University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ust
Gregory Abrams Davidson Solicitors recover damages for injuries arising as a result of a failure to action the results of a colonoscopy that indicated that the deceased required polyp excision, which would have been curative. The deceased was diagnosed with colorectal cancer with metastases 3 years later and died shortly after as a result of the malignancies
